Chelles' air quality reflects Greater Paris' eastern inner suburb on the Marne river, with vehicle traffic on the A4 and A104 motorways and the surrounding residential and commercial character generating elevated NOₓ. The Marne river corridor provides limited ventilation, while prevailing westerlies carry the broader Paris metropolitan pollution eastward through the Marne valley and the dense suburban character maintains consistent moderate to elevated readings throughout the year.

Are air quality levels in Chelles based on measurements or forecasts?

It is forecasts derived by downscaling forecasts provided by EU’s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service (CAMS) by taking into account local conditions such as traffic patterns. CAMS bases its forecast on satellite measurements of particles and chemical compounds in the atmosphere.
